+Outside Window Repair: A Comprehensive Guide
Windows are vital elements of any structure, providing not only visual appeal however likewise important functions like insulation and security. With time, windows can weaken due to climate condition, aging materials, or accidental damage, particularly on the outside sides. This post serves as a useful guide to outside window repair, outlining typical concerns, repair methods, and maintenance pointers to assist homeowners and structure managers keep their windows in ideal condition.
Typical Outside Window Problems
Several concerns can impact the outside of windows, resulting in the requirement for repair. Below is a table highlighting a few of the most common problems faced:
ProblemDescriptionCracked or Broken GlassDamage to the glass pane that can lead to drafts and leaks.Rotted Wood FramesWood impacted by moisture, triggering structural weak points.Peeling or Flaking PaintDegeneration of the paint finish, resulting in direct exposure of basic materials.Misaligned WindowsWindows that do closed or close properly due to shifting frames.Leaky SealsCompromised seals that result in wetness buildup between panes.Cracked or Broken Glass
Cracks and breaks in window glass are among the most worrying concerns property owners might deal with. Not just do they compromise the insulation residential or commercial properties of windows, but they can likewise posture safety threats. Fixing or replacing broken glass can bring back a window's performance and aesthetic appeal.
Rotted Wood Frames
Wood window frames are susceptible to damage from moisture, bugs, and the wear of time. When wood begins to rot, it can lead to structural instability. Persistent assessment and prompt repairs are essential to avoid additional damage.
Peeling or Flaking Paint
The outside paint on windows is important for security against the elements. When paint begins to peel or flake, it exposes the underlying products to wetness and can lead to substantial damage over time.
Misaligned Windows
Windows that have actually ended up being misaligned can be a problem and might result in more problems like drafts and leakages. Routine maintenance checks can help determine misaligned windows before they become a larger concern.
Dripping Seals
Seals are crucial for keeping energy efficiency in windows. When seals fail, condensation can form, reducing visibility and insulation efficiency. Regular checks of window seals can help catch leakages early before they cause pricey repairs.
Repair Techniques and Tools
To address these common window problems, various repair methods and tools are offered. The efficiency of each repair approach depends largely on the particular problem came across.
Tools Required for Outside Window RepairsToolPurposeGlass CutterFor cutting and shaping brand-new glass panes.Putty KnifeFor using putty or sealant.Caulking GunTo use caulk for sealing spaces.SandpaperFor smoothing rough surfaces.PaintbrushFor applying paint or sealant.ScrewdriverFor getting rid of or tightening up screws.Repair Techniques
Changing Broken Glass
Remove the window from its frame.Carefully cut out the broken glass using a glass cutter.Procedure and cut brand-new glass to size.Install the new glass pane, securing it with putty or glazing compound.
Fixing Rotted Wood Frames
Eliminate any loose or decaying wood using a chisel or saw.Fill little holes with a wood filler, and for bigger areas, use a wood epoxy.Sand the area smooth as soon as dried, and repaint for protection.
Repainting Windows
Eliminate old paint with a scraper and sandpaper.Tidy the surface thoroughly before applying a guide.Once primed, utilize a premium exterior paint to finish.
Straightening Windows
Loosen screws or brackets that hold the window in location.Adjust the window until it is lined up correctly.Tighten the screws to protect the window in its new position.
Sealing Leaks

Preventive upkeep can extend the lifespan of windows and minimize the frequency of repairs. Below is a list of pointers for keeping outside windows:
Regular Inspections: Conduct routine checks to try to find indications of damage or wear.Cleaning up: Keep windows tidy to avoid dirt accumulation that can hide problems.Weatherstripping: Replace weatherstripping as required to preserve energy effectiveness.Paint Maintenance: Repaint window frames every couple of years to safeguard against the elements.Rain gutter Cleaning: Ensure rain gutters are clean to avoid water overflow that can harm window frames.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. How typically should I check my windows for damage?
It is recommended to inspect windows at least twice a year, preferably in the spring and fall, to catch any issues before they intensify.
2. Can I replace window glass myself?
Yes, changing window [local glass repair](https://posteezy.com/how-do-i-explain-sliding-window-repair-5-year-old) can be a DIY task if you have the right tools and perseverance. Nevertheless, for bigger windows or complicated installations, employing a professional is suggested.
3. What type of paint should I utilize for exterior window frames?
Constantly choose high-quality outside paint that is resistant to moisture and UV rays to ensure resilience.
4. How can I inform if my window seals are dripping?
Indications of dripping seals consist of condensation in between the panes, a drop in energy performance, and visible wetness buildup.
5. Is it worth repairing old windows or should I replace them?
It depends upon the extent of the damage. If repairs are minor and the frames are structurally sound, fixing may be cost-efficient. Nevertheless, if the windows are old and regularly problematic, replacement may be a better long-lasting financial investment.
